What is a Kathoey Cabaret Show?

The term Kathoey has a long and complex history within Thai language and culture. In contemporary usage, it is often associated with transgender women, although the meaning of the word can vary depending on context and individual identity.

A Kathoey cabaret show is a form of theatrical entertainment in which performers use music, dance, comedy, elaborate costumes and stage performance to create a spectacular evening for audiences.

The emphasis is on performance and artistry.

Rather than simply being a sequence of songs, many modern cabaret productions combine storytelling, comedy, choreography and visual spectacle.

Performers can spend years developing their skills, learning choreography and perfecting the presentation required for professional cabaret.

The result is an energetic form of entertainment that has become internationally recognised.

Ladyboys, Performance and Thai Culture

The visibility of ladyboys in Thai entertainment has attracted international interest for decades.

It is important, however, to remember that performers are individuals first. Being a performer does not mean every member of the transgender community has the same experiences, identity or relationship with Thai culture.

The word Kathoey has a particular cultural context within Thailand, while the English words transgender, woman and other gender identities can describe people in different ways.

Cabaret is one part of a much larger cultural picture.

Performers may choose entertainment because they love the stage, enjoy performing, have exceptional talent or simply see it as a fulfilling job.

Their professional skills deserve to be recognised in exactly the same way as those of any other theatrical performer.

Meet FULL MOON: The Ladyboys of Bangkok in 2026

In 2026, The Ladyboys of Bangkok return with FULL MOON, a vibrant new production combining cabaret with a continuous theatrical story, a highlight of The Ladyboys of Bangkok blog’s insights into the show.

Set against the backdrop of Thailand’s legendary Full Moon celebrations, the production begins with a glamorous beach party.

Everything appears ready for an unforgettable celebration.

Then an eccentric magician attempts a spectacular illusion.

Something goes very wrong.

The magician’s failed trick triggers a chain of surreal events that transforms the evening into a journey filled with mystery, comedy, music and unexpected twists.

This is where FULL MOON differs from a conventional cabaret show.

Rather than simply presenting individual songs one after another, the production uses recurring characters, visual themes and narrative elements to connect the entire performance.

Audiences are taken on a theatrical journey through one extraordinary night.
